Charles Leclerc Anticipates ‘Extremely Positive’ Impact of Lewis Hamilton’s Arrival at Ferrari for F1 2025
Charles Leclerc discusses the potential influence Lewis Hamilton could bring to Ferrari when he joins the team in the 2025 F1 season.
Charles Leclerc thinks that Lewis Hamilton joining Ferrari in the 2025 F1 season will be very beneficial.
Seven-time world champion Hamilton is set to make a historic move in Formula 1 by switching from Mercedes to the Italian team with a multi-year contract starting next season.
Leclerc is thrilled about the opportunity to compete directly with F1’s most accomplished driver using identical cars. He believes it will be "extremely interesting" to gain insights from the 39-year-old, whom the Monegasque racer regards as "one of the best in history".
"Of course, it's incredibly positive," Leclerc mentioned on the Beyond the Grid podcast in response to a question about the effect Hamilton joining Ferrari would have.
"When a champion of Lewis's caliber joins a team, it inspires and energizes every member of the group."
"The primary beneficial impact on Ferrari will be the fresh perspective and extensive experience he brings from Mercedes, introducing a new approach and vision that will undoubtedly advantage the team."
"In my opinion, it will be incredible to share the same car with the most accomplished driver in F1 history. This presents a unique opportunity for me to learn from one of the greatest, while also serving as a significant challenge and motivation to outperform Lewis and demonstrate my own abilities."
Hamilton will become Leclerc’s third partner in seven years at Ferrari, succeeding the likes of multiple world champions Sebastian Vettel and Carlos Sainz. Leclerc consistently outshone Vettel over their two-year stint together and has generally maintained an edge over Sainz.
When questioned about his emotions if he managed to surpass Hamilton while driving the same car, Leclerc replied, “I’m not sure, and to be honest, it’s not something I’m considering at this point.”
"I aim to concentrate on my own performance and be the best I can be when he arrives. Of course, I strive to be at my best every time I’m on the track, but with Lewis joining the team, he will certainly set a high standard. Therefore, it’s crucial for me to perform at my highest level, and then we'll see what happens."
"I'll put in my maximum effort, he'll do the same, and then we'll find out the outcome. Afterward, I can share how it feels if I succeed."
Leclerc mentioned that he has devoted more time this year to becoming acquainted with Hamilton.
"Everything is relative, but within the paddock, he's certainly one of the drivers we've talked about the most lately, particularly in terms of our shared interests in music and fashion," he stated.
“It was beneficial to discuss this topic specifically, but we haven’t spent a lot of time together outside of those discussions.”
"That will naturally occur when he becomes part of the team, as we'll have additional responsibilities off the track, allowing us to become better acquainted."
